Skip to main content

Unofficial CNB command-line tool built with Rust

Project description

cnb-rs

PyPI Python Downloads Release CNB Repo License

Unofficial CNB command-line tool built with Rust.

Requirements

  • Python >= 3.8

Installation

# Using uv (recommended)
uvx cnb-rs --help

# Using pipx
pipx install cnb-rs

# Using pip
pip install cnb-rs

Usage

Once installed, the cnb-rs binary is available on your PATH:

cnb-rs --help
cnb-rs auth login
cnb-rs issue list
cnb-rs pr list

You can also invoke it via Python:

python -m cnb_rs --help

Links

License

GPL-3.0-or-later

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

cnb_rs-1.0.0rc1.tar.gz (535.3 kB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

cnb_rs-1.0.0rc1-py3-none-win_arm64.whl (2.9 MB view details)

Uploaded Python 3Windows ARM64

cnb_rs-1.0.0rc1-py3-none-win_amd64.whl (3.0 MB view details)

Uploaded Python 3Windows x86-64

cnb_rs-1.0.0rc1-py3-none-musllinux_1_2_x86_64.whl (3.6 MB view details)

Uploaded Python 3musllinux: musl 1.2+ x86-64

cnb_rs-1.0.0rc1-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(3.5 MB view details)

Uploaded Python 3manylinux: glibc 2.17+ x86-64

cnb_rs-1.0.0rc1-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l (3.6 MB view details)

Uploaded Python 3manylinux: glibc 2.17+ ARM64

cnb_rs-1.0.0rc1-py3-none-macosx_11_0_arm64.whl (3.0 MB view details)

Uploaded Python 3macOS 11.0+ ARM64

cnb_rs-1.0.0rc1-py3-none-macosx_10_12_x86_64.whl (3.1 MB view details)

Uploaded Python 3macOS 10.12+ x86-64

File details

Details for the file cnb_rs-1.0.0rc1.tar.gz.

File metadata

  • Download URL: cnb_rs-1.0.0rc1.tar.gz
  • Upload date:
  • Size: 535.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.21 {"installer":{"name":"uv","version":"0.11.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for cnb_rs-1.0.0rc1.tar.gz
Algorithm Hash digest
SHA256 2300bbcda9634dac6808e95bc08655fc91042c46cc13c20f0906442f403aa7ae
MD5 133af4bc08992e066961afc169bb679a
BLAKE2b-256 580164efa3f6b254e589cef4e3deffc249445539a9059c5be57112e2668112d7

See more details on using hashes here.

File details

Details for the file cnb_rs-1.0.0rc1-py3-none-win_arm64.whl.

File metadata

  • Download URL: cnb_rs-1.0.0rc1-py3-none-win_arm64.whl
  • Upload date:
  • Size: 2.9 MB
  • Tags: Python 3, Windows ARM64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.21 {"installer":{"name":"uv","version":"0.11.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for cnb_rs-1.0.0rc1-py3-none-win_arm64.whl
Algorithm Hash digest
SHA256 3b2e74e07edc11e115f018aa81cbce6d331b3f7dc3b5ab6c5d2e235bb011eefc
MD5 9a00f2a8bde40b2ab361a14c73867d31
BLAKE2b-256 578d5d289495119310293345e91b9638493b4e1478738cc3d3231b02567c0cfd

See more details on using hashes here.

File details

Details for the file cnb_rs-1.0.0rc1-py3-none-win_amd64.whl.

File metadata

  • Download URL: cnb_rs-1.0.0rc1-py3-none-win_amd64.whl
  • Upload date:
  • Size: 3.0 MB
  • Tags: Python 3, Windows x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.21 {"installer":{"name":"uv","version":"0.11.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for cnb_rs-1.0.0rc1-py3-none-win_amd64.whl
Algorithm Hash digest
SHA256 4c6b79a01139b407d97094896c82f16d60325b22f7831293d2db0db2bc851d79
MD5 c3fe7468eb1405e2be22a49914155c8f
BLAKE2b-256 836beb420e08bc2107c2497a2502f9cdcc4fad7419dc75d7219dbdd3f52de433

See more details on using hashes here.

File details

Details for the file cnb_rs-1.0.0rc1-py3-none-musllinux_1_2_x86_64.whl.

File metadata

  • Download URL: cnb_rs-1.0.0rc1-py3-none-musllinux_1_2_x86_64.whl
  • Upload date:
  • Size: 3.6 MB
  • Tags: Python 3, musllinux: musl 1.2+ x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.21 {"installer":{"name":"uv","version":"0.11.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for cnb_rs-1.0.0rc1-py3-none-musllinux_1_2_x86_64.whl
Algorithm Hash digest
SHA256 91bdc48d4a01c7abbe981f0b0fa716073fd641791bd2e766336116f5f2bfc9c8
MD5 ad5d1fb80521eed52bdffbf001e819f5
BLAKE2b-256 8c45847405d6e9d2a91636e7b549aa7b53e68ddce96fc7d4aa0acb363f2cd5c6

See more details on using hashes here.

File details

Details for the file cnb_rs-1.0.0rc1-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

  • Download URL: cnb_rs-1.0.0rc1-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
  • Upload date:
  • Size: 3.5 MB
  • Tags: Python 3, manylinux: glibc 2.17+ x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.21 {"installer":{"name":"uv","version":"0.11.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for cnb_rs-1.0.0rc1-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 911d331a265b89f051d86c18af4b5be528f74f452e64d39b87a47220e5cce9d1
MD5 e62df8f6a219a103858d63f85be72be9
BLAKE2b-256 7286293ef33eda544ba7786e5230e86d3b0cf3fe775518aed366c82dd9f1000d

See more details on using hashes here.

File details

Details for the file cnb_rs-1.0.0rc1-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l.

File metadata

  • Download URL: cnb_rs-1.0.0rc1-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l
  • Upload date:
  • Size: 3.6 MB
  • Tags: Python 3, manylinux: glibc 2.17+ ARM64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.21 {"installer":{"name":"uv","version":"0.11.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for cnb_rs-1.0.0rc1-py3-none-manylinux_2_17_aarch64.manylinux2014_aarch64.whl
Algorithm Hash digest
SHA256 3a6aaa0faf9c0fdb44768c492676851a97ab9ce0772afebc03e2e37482913f39
MD5 13e1e29ffa80d1cec6a37a2031a5e3b3
BLAKE2b-256 a202fcb48379641b6274794f0b9b7e0319e665d206d733c71de438a2310d0be8

See more details on using hashes here.

File details

Details for the file cnb_rs-1.0.0rc1-py3-none-macosx_11_0_arm64.whl.

File metadata

  • Download URL: cnb_rs-1.0.0rc1-py3-none-macosx_11_0_arm64.whl
  • Upload date:
  • Size: 3.0 MB
  • Tags: Python 3, macOS 11.0+ ARM64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.21 {"installer":{"name":"uv","version":"0.11.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for cnb_rs-1.0.0rc1-py3-none-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 f7baed041216a3fe12a3774c984ed38557f251871eaa466cf73418370fca66fd
MD5 47ab1b26f0238ef6dae150a1338281a7
BLAKE2b-256 a0419d61729aca78edf1fcc51ccef74d993e4478a4427f9c3d86f0c538c89c02

See more details on using hashes here.

File details

Details for the file cnb_rs-1.0.0rc1-py3-none-macosx_10_12_x86_64.whl.

File metadata

  • Download URL: cnb_rs-1.0.0rc1-py3-none-macosx_10_12_x86_64.whl
  • Upload date:
  • Size: 3.1 MB
  • Tags: Python 3, macOS 10.12+ x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.11.21 {"installer":{"name":"uv","version":"0.11.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for cnb_rs-1.0.0rc1-py3-none-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 e4520c4ced1bd9b9e017d99df2c4e9940ff16373ab4914daa0ceb3ebd76c870d
MD5 4433a9448526708664009dcc5305f00b
BLAKE2b-256 693de7bd4993893c5ba1faa1f8acf1f897e30a7dedf2d3855a3c7328fa56de39

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page